Mercy In Black
~*Marge Tindal*~

Upon the cast of circle
she comes, your witness to bear
The gravedigger stands ready
waiting eagerly in the lair
Not without her canting
has she bound you to the grave
Angel Of Black Mercy descends
to cast you on your way

How dark the soul that none do cry
No tears of grief spill in goodbye
Fear ye not, the taking back
You shall be tended by Mercy In Black
